What are Customer types?

Customer types are discounted pricing categories that allow you to offer special rates to specific groups of customers, such as students, military, police or veterans, seniors, children, or industry workers. This feature helps you implement tiered pricing strategies while maintaining clear records of who receives which discounts.


Before You Begin

  • Ensure you have appropriate staff permissions to access Settings

  • Identify which customer groups you want to offer Customer types to

  • Determine the discount percentages or fixed amounts for each group

Step 1: Navigate to Customer types Settings

  1. From the left-hand navigation menu, click on Settings

  2. Select Customer types from the settings menu


Step 2: Create a New Customer type

  1. Click the + Create new button
    Create a Customer type name (Examples include: College student, Local Gym staff etc)

  1. Assign a Color, this will help identify customers with a customer type at POS, Check-in and Customer accounts

  2. Add a Description to help staff understand who qualifies for this concession, make this very clear and easy to understand

  3. Assign a Default Duration, a drop down with duration is selectable

  4. Define the Document the customer needs to provide as proof.

  5. Toggle the File upload requirement if you wish to have staff take a copy of the documentation.

  6. Activate! Inactive types cannot be assigned to a customer.

Step 3: Apply Customer types to a Customers account

Once Customer types are created, you can apply them to a Customers account as a desk staff.

  • Navigate to a Customer

  • Select “Assign customer type”

  • Selecting the Customer Type will give you a drop down menu of all the Customer types you have previously created.

  • If you have created a Customer Type that requires ID to be uploaded or validated, the requirements will be shown in the sidebar.


Customer types will now appear on the customers profile and in the customer list as a colored bar with the title.
